【关于js 中函数的传参】教程文章相关的互联网学习教程文章

比较精简的Javascript拖动效果函数代码_javascript技巧

拖动效果函数演示 by Longbill.cn body { font-size:12px; color:#333333; border : 0px solid blue; } div { position : absolute; background-color : #c3d9ff; margin : 0px; padding : 5px; border : 0px; width : 100px; height:100px; } function drag(o,s) { if (typeof o == "string") o = document.getElementById(o); o.orig_x = parseInt(o.style.left) - document.body.scrollLeft; o.ori...

javascript中如何终止函数操作代码详解

1、如果终止一个函数的用return即可,实例如下:function testA(){alert(a);alert(b);alert(c); }testA(); 程序执行会依次弹出a,b,c。function testA(){alert(a);return;alert(b);alert(c); }testA(); 程序执行弹出a便会终止。2、在函数中调用别的函数,在被调用函数终止的同时也希望调用的函数终止,实例如下:function testC(){alert(c);return;alert(cc); }function testD(){testC();alert(d); }我们看到在testD中调用了testC,...

javascript – 递归函数的流注释【代码】

我对如何为这样的函数编写流类型注释感兴趣:const Box = x => ({map: f => Box(f(x)),fold: f => f(x), });我想,类型注释应该使用泛型.功能用法示例:const getRandomColor = (): string =>Box(Math.random()).map(x => x * 0xFFFFFF).map(Math.floor).map(x => x.toString(16)).fold(x => `#${x.padStart(0, 6)}`);P.S.:如果不可能,请写下解释为什么不可能. 遗憾的是,@ Isitea的答案不合适,因为他更改了源代码,这不是重点.解决方...

javascript – 如何在Typescript中实现JS函数指针【代码】

我在Javascript中有以下内容:var chartOptions = {chartType: settings.chartType, }chartOptions.func = function(chart) {chartOptions.fullChart = chart; }一切正常. 但是我想把它改成TypeScript并且是新的,我不确定如何做到这一点.请有人帮忙吗?例如,’func’没有符号,’fullChart’没有符号,那么这怎么会在Javascript中起作用?解决方法:您可以修复代码,将属性添加到chartOptions:var chartOptions = {chartType: setting...

深入解析jQuery.data,jQuery._data以及data实例函数的用法及注意事项

问题1:jQuery内部的数据保存的格式是什么,通过data保存的数据和注册的事件格式有什么区别?首先看下面的代码: $._data($("#data")[0],"name","qinliang");$._data($("#data")[0],"sex","male");$("#data").click(function(){console.log("click1");});$("#data").click(function(){console.log("click2");});$("#data").mouseover(function(){console.log("click");});//data保存的数据通过result.name,result.sex访问//在DOM...

jQuery.trigger()函数使用教程

trigger()函数用于在每个匹配元素上触发指定类型的事件。此外,你还可以在触发事件时为事件处理函数传入额外的参数。使用该函数可以手动触发执行元素上绑定的事件处理函数,也会触发执行该元素的默认行为。以表单元素<form>为例,使用trigger("submit")可以触发该表单绑定的submit事件,也会执行表单submit事件的默认行为——表单提交操作。根据网友 @飞扬 的反馈,链接标签<a>的trigger("click")是一个特例,不会触发链接click事件...

js中apply和Math.max()函数的问题及区别介绍

这篇文章主要介绍了js中apply和Math.max()函数的问题,本文给大家带来两种答案,每一种答案给大家介绍的非常详细,在文章底部给大家提到了js中Math.max.apply和Math.max的区别,感兴趣的朋友一起看看吧下面给大家介绍js中apply和Math.max()函数的问题,具体内容如下所示:var arr=[1,3,6,3,7,9,2]; console.log(Math.max.apply(null,arr));一直搞不懂为什么这样可以算出一个数组的最大值?一直想不明白,请js高手指教一下。答案1 F...

javascript学习笔记之函数定义

函数声明式 function funname( 参数 ){...执行的代码}声明式的函数并不会马上执行,需要我们调用才会执行:funname(); * 分号是用来分隔可执行JavaScript语句,由于函数声明不是一个可执行语句,所以不以分号结束。 函数表达式 var x = function( 参数 ){...执行的代码块};函数表达式定义的函数,实际上也是一个匿名函数(这个函数没有名字,直接存储在变量中) * 函数表达式结尾是要加分号的,因为它是一个执行语句。 Function ...

通过JavaScript函数调用p:remoteCommand,该函数通过“ oncomplete”处理函数将该函数本地的消息传递给另一个函数【代码】

该问题纯粹基于先前提出的this(courtesy)问题,但是该问题与Java EE 7 WebSockets API完全搞混了,试图显示实际的实际方法/场景,现在不太可能收到基于< p的任何答案:remoteCommand取代.在下面的一段JavaScript中给出(这只是一个测试场景). <script type="text/javascript">function test() {var message = "myMessage";window["myFunction"]();// This is literally interpreted as a JavaScript function "myFunction()".// "myFun...

带有对象表示法的javascript函数参数【代码】

有什么区别function updateSomething(item) {}和function updateSomething({items}) {}?第一个中的item变量也可以是一个对象,为什么第二个使用对象表示法呢?我什么时候应该使用第一个和后一个?最佳答案:这是参数解构,来自ES2015.在第二种情况下,您将局部变量初始化为参数的items属性的值.function updateSomething({items}) {大致相当于function updateSomething(obj) {var items = obj.items;其他一些例子here和here. 从MDN:P...

javascript节点遍历函数_javascript技巧

火狐官网上找到的一组函数,相当于treeWalker,有了它可以方便地在IE实现Traversal API 2的所有功能(nextElementSibling,previousElementSibling,firstElementChild,lastElementChild,children)These functions let you find the next sibling, previous sibling, first child, and last child of a given node (element). What makes them unique is that they safely ignore whitespace nodes so you get the real node yo...

Chrome扩展程序:插入javascript标记并调用函数【代码】

我有一个chrome扩展,它使用内容脚本来动态插入引用an external javascript file的脚本标记.我使用的代码是:var html_doc = document.getElementsByTagName('head')[0]; var _js = document.createElement('script'); _js.setAttribute('type', 'text/javascript'); _js.setAttribute('id', 'chr_js'); _js.setAttribute('src', 'http://unixpapa.com/js/dyna1.js'); if(!document.getElementById('chr_js')) html_doc.appe...

PHP中使用JavaScript时,alert函数乱码怎么办?【代码】【图】

PHP中使用JavaScript时,alert函数乱码的解决办法:1、html语言中指定字符集,利用【<meta>】标签;2、检查文件的编码方式;3、利用echo函数输出。PHP中使用JavaScript时,alert函数乱码的解决办法:1、html语言中指定字符集,利用<meta>标签Example:<html><head><title>编码那点事</title><meta http-equiv="Content-Type" content="text/html; charset=utf-8" /></head> </html>2、检查文件的编码方式以Dreamwaver CS4为例,看看...

cf不能全屏win7的解决方法js下函数般调用正则的方法附代码

曾经 ECMAScript 4 建议指出这个功能将会增加到 ES4 规范中,但后来的在 ES4-discuss mailing list 的讨论中,这个建议可能被废除。 然而,你可以通过增加 call 和 apply 方法到 RegExp.prototype 中类似的现实这些方法。既有助于功能设计,又可实现对函数和正则表达式均有效的隐藏类型(duck-typed )代码。因此,让我们增加这些方法。 RegExp.prototype.call = function (context, str) { return this.exec(str); }; RegExp....

javascript、php关键字搜索函数的使用方法

这篇文章主要介绍了javascript、php关键字搜索函数的使用方法的相关资料,需要的朋友可以参考下。javascript:a. 代码:/* @desc:js搜索函数,可用于关键字匹配 @param key 关键字 @param str 要搜索的字符串 @return out 匹配关键字前后出现的位置 */ function search(key,str){ var min = 0 var max = str.length var index = str.indexOf(key) var left = index - 10 var right = index + 10 if(left<min){left = min } if(righ...

JAVASCRIPT - 技术教程分类
JavaScript 教程 JavaScript 简介 JavaScript 用法 JavaScript Chrome 中运行 JavaScript 输出 JavaScript 语法 JavaScript 语句 JavaScript 注释 JavaScript 变量 JavaScript 数据类型 JavaScript 对象 JavaScript 函数 JavaScript 作用域 JavaScript 事件 JavaScript 字符串 JavaScript 运算符 JavaScript 比较 JavaScript 条件语句 JavaScript switch 语句 JavaScript for 循环 JavaScript while 循环 JavaScript break 和 continue 语... JavaScript typeof JavaScript 类型转换 JavaScript 正则表达式 JavaScript 错误 JavaScript 调试 JavaScript 变量提升 JavaScript 严格模式 JavaScript 使用误区 JavaScript 表单 JavaScript 表单验证 JavaScript 验证 API JavaScript 保留关键字 JavaScript this JavaScript let 和 const JavaScript JSON JavaScript void JavaScript 异步编程 JavaScript Promise JavaScript 代码规范 JavaScript 函数定义 JavaScript 函数参数 JavaScript 函数调用 JavaScript 闭包 DOM 简介 DOM HTML DOM CSS DOM 事件 DOM EventListener DOM 元素 HTMLCollection 对象 NodeList 对象 JavaScript 对象 JavaScript prototype JavaScript Number 对象 JavaScript String JavaScript Date(日期) JavaScript Array(数组) JavaScript Boolean(布尔) JavaScript Math(算数) JavaScript RegExp 对象 JavaScript Window JavaScript Window Location JavaScript Navigator JavaScript 弹窗 JavaScript 计时事件 JavaScript Cookie JavaScript 库 JavaScript 实例 JavaScript 对象实例 JavaScript 浏览器对象实例 JavaScript HTML DOM 实例 JavaScript 总结 JavaScript 对象 HTML DOM 对象 JavaScript 异步编程 javascript 全部